1. Consider where you are travelling to

Some travel insurance coverage are destination-specific whereas others are worldwide. The level of travel insurance cover and the cost of travel insurance for Mali can differ depending upon the locations you’re preparing to travel. Risks in some areas or countries might be of higher issue than others to the travel insurance company.

  • Choose a travel insurance coverage that covers you for every single country you are preparing to go, and this must consist of any stay locations and transit points.
  • Check the current scenario or travel advisory notifies for Mali for the destination you are travelling to.
  • Make certain your destination’s travel suggestions level is not’ Do not travel’. Inspect if your travel insurance plan covers you for cancellations if the travel recommendations level for Mali goes up after you’ve scheduled.

2. Decide on the duration of your trip

Travel insurer normally use travel insurance coverage estimates for Mali based on the number of days you will be far from your country of permanent residence.

  • Single Trip Travel Insurance Cover for Mali is good for travellers who are preparing a fast journey as these are for a set number of days.
  • Multi Trip Travel Insurance for Mali is great if you take a trip to Mali often.
  • Annual Travel Insurance for Mali are ideal for prolonged periods of travel in Mali as this kind of policy may wind up being more convenient and better value.
  • Domestic health insurance cover for Mali must be thought about in Mali if you are going to Mali for long-lasting to live or work as many travel insurance plan might not cover you. Seek advice from a travel insurance coverage insurer to get more information.

If you are purchasing an annual multi-trip travel insurance plan for Mali or thinking of utilizing your credit card for travel insurance policies, then inspect the optimum number of days are covered in each trip in Mali as many yearly travel insurance plan have a limit from 15 to 365 days, depending upon small print in your policy. Some travel insurance service providers permit you to spend for extra days.

3. Think about what you’ll do in Mali

The majority of travel insurance covers for Mali in the market omit several activities in their standard travel insurance policies. In many situations, you may require to pay additional to guarantee you are covered for what you are planning to do in Mali. It is important to check the travel insurance coverage’s fine print, and these consist of:

  • Check the list of activities that are specifically included or left out in your insurance.
  • Check their definitions for activities like walking in the mountains may be thought about mountain climbing above a specific altitude.
  • You may need to pay for extra cover for certain activities like snowboarding, bungee jumping, diving, hiking or riding a motorcycle.
  • If you are preparing to drive in Mali, check to see whether your travel insurance can cover you or can pay additional to cover you. In many cases, getting automobile hire insurance from your travel insurance provider is cheaper than getting another cars and truck hire insurance coverage from the automobile hire business.

If you are planning to live a long period of time in Mali, there may be other insurance requirements to fulfill such as the visa conditions to get a regional medical insurance policy.

4. Your age and the state of your health

Your age and health will affect the kind of travel insurance policy you need, and just how much it costs you. This especially applies to people with pre-existing medical conditions.

  • When purchasing a travel insurance plan, you should declare all your pre-existing medical conditions. Ask your travel insurance service provider if you are unsure whether your medical condition is covered.
  • In some instances, the travel insurer may ask for a medical evaluation. It is essential to ask your travel insurance provider if they will cover your medical condition automatically or you will require an assessment.
  • Most travel insurance coverage have an age limitation. There are travel insurance policies for seniors in the market.

5. Personal valuables

Costly individual items may cost you more to guarantee and for that reason it is very important to think about what you are taking with you when you travel. The expense to replace products if they get lost, stolen or damaged must be considered when buying a travel insurance coverage.

Travel insurance coverage vary when it concerns how they cover valuable products. Many travel insurance covers frequently have limits on the value for each item, and including cover for valuables can vary.

  • Check specific item limitations on your travel insurance luggage cover. You may require to get additional travel insurance to cover your valuables properly.
  • Check the excess on your travel insurance coverage cover as the excess in many policies are more than the value of key products you are taking with you. You can think about paying additional to decrease or get rid of the excess on your travel insurance coverage cover.
  • Always check the small print on your travel insurance coverage policy declaration( PDS) and see what products they omit, and the situations they will cover.
